Job Description

General Summary:

The Senior Director, Area Field Leader (AFL) is a second line sales leader responsible for developing, leading, and coaching a team of 8 Regional Field Leaders (RFLs) who each manage a team of 8-10 reps; account managers and territory managers. Pain Territory Account Managers (PTAMs) focus on driving and pulling through hospitals/health system volume and access, expand activation and breadth of prescribers within the hospital setting. Pain Territory Business Managers (TBMs) focus within the PTAM's surrounding community, calling upon PCPs, oral surgeons, and selected specialties-to broaden reach and accelerate appropriate, on label adoption within these community targets.

This role reports into the Vice President, Field Sales & Strategic Customer Engagement, U.S. Commercial, Pain. This role will join a team of 3 existing Area Field Leaders (AFLs) and will be responsible for ~80 field-based employees across 8 regions.

The Senior Director must live within the geographic area they are leading.
